Roma, the personification of the city.Welcome to Eutropius.com. This website is the home of an original translation of Eutropius' short Roman history, the "Breviarium Ab Urbe Condita."  I have titled my translation of this work "A Brief History From the Founding of the City."

Eutropius wrote his work around the year 370 A.D. and dedicated it to the emperor Valens. His book briefly touches on almost every significant Roman personality and event, from the city's founding to Valens' reign, late in the empire. It's more than eleven hundred years of Roman history in under one hundred pages.
